    My problem with this watch is legibility. I have tried the panda version, the gold Arabic numerals and blue numerals. Although the discontinued panda version was my preference I found that there was a lot of glare and was almost impossible to tell time. I found the white with blue numerals to be the easiest to read. I like that this watch is very thin for chronograph standards and size wise is also very good. One thing to note is that I found to look nicer when seeing the watch on someone else’s wrist than mine. I found it a bit plain for my taste when on my wrist

    that said, it's one of THE most overpriced watches on the market (as are the vast majority of IWCs). for a 5th (or less) of the price you get 95% of this watch (though thicker and longer l2l) with various other manufacturers (junghas, archimede, hamilton...). the value-for-money proposition is insanely low. as much as i absolutely adore the looks, i'd only buy it if i had enough money that literally burning 7-8k euros would mean nothing to me.
    that said, the criticism about the movement is quite... unfair. i agree the finishing is atrocious. hell, it's so bad it would be poor at 500€, let alone the price they're asking. put let me ask the critics this: how many chronos with the 7750 can you name that are under 13mm thick with a diameter of 41 or less? here's a hint: 0
    but i'll reiterate: as good as it looks, you'd be hard pressed to find poorer value-for-money in the this price bracket (or any price bracket. really), even used
